IPI to pay $3.4M for alleged FLSA violations

U.S. Labor Secretary R. Alexander Acosta has filed a lawsuit in federal court against Imperial Pacific International Holdings Ltd. and its subsidiary, Imperial Pacific International (CNMI) LLC, for alleged violations of the Fair Labor Standards Act over the construction of...

Guam selected as Virgin Orbit’s launch site

HAGÅTÑA, Guam—Guam has been selected as a launch site for Virgin Orbit’s LauncherOne Service. A first launch from the island could occur in as little as a year’s time. “This is a rare opportunity for our island to be front and center of a groundbreaking space industry,” said...
